#7d883e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d883e is composed of 49% red, 53.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.4%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 68.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.4% and a lightness of 38.8%. #7d883e color hex could be obtained by blending #faff7c with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#7d883e color description : Dark moderate yellow.

#7d883e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7d883e has RGB values of R:125, G:136,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8226878.

Shades and Tints of #7d883e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d883e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686a5c is the less saturated color, while #a8c501 is the most saturated one.
